EAN 959J is a 1970 Land Rover Series 3 in Green with a 2,286c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 1970 Land Rover Series 3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.7% with a typical mileage of 56,860 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Land Rover Series 3 fails its MOT is suspension spring m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 927 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EAN 959J,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Land Rover Series 3 typically stays on UK roads for around 56 years. At 56 years old, this Land Rover Series 3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
